Aaah yes. The Great "Bucephalus" - famous charger of Alexander the Great. Many legends surround this big horse including that he feared his shadow and when Alexander turned him into the sun and the horse no longer saw his shadow, he was tamed.

Bucephalus was the name of Alexander the Great's horse.

It's also the name of Baron Munchausen's horse. This stallion could dance on a table, run even when cut in half and leap off the top of a castle or high cliff and land intact, with rider still in the saddle. A remarkable steed indeed!
